Makarenko, Anton Semyonovich

    0.03 sec.
Makarenko, Anton Semyonovich, 1888–1939, Russian educator. In the 1920s, Makarenko organized the Gorky Colony, a home for children left homeless by the Russian Revolution Russian Revolution, violent upheaval in Russia in 1917 that overthrew the czarist government.
